Bacon And Tomato Jam

7 ingredients
11 steps

Ingredients

  • 1/2 lb smoked bacon
  • 2 lbs firm ripe tomatoes, cored and chopped
  • 1 medium yellow onion, diced
  • 1 cup sugar
  • 2 1/2 tablespoons cider vinegar
  • 1 1/2 teaspoons salt
  • 1/4 teaspoon ground black pepper

Directions

  1. 1
    In a large skillet over medium-high, cook the bacon until crispy, about 5 minutes.
  2. 2
    Transfer the bacon to paper towels to drain excess fat, blotting it dry with additional towels as needed.
  3. 3
    In a large saucepan, combine the tomatoes, onion, sugar, cider vinegar, salt and pepper.
  4. 4
    Bring to a boil, stirring often, then reduce heat to medium.
  5. 5
    Crumble the bacon into the tomato mixture.
  6. 6
    Simmer until very thick, about 1 hour.
  7. 7
    Season with additional salt and pepper as needed.
  8. 8
    Let the jam cool, then ladle into jars.
  9. 9
    Can be refrigerated for 3 to 4 days, or frozen up to 2 months.
  10. 10
    If freezing, divide the jam among several small jars.
  11. 11
    When ready to use, let the jar thaw overnight in the refrigerator.
